Overview of Key Volleyball Metrics

Key volleyball metrics provide essential insights into player performance and team dynamics. Important statistics include:

  • Attack Efficiency: Measures the success rate of attacks.
  • Serve Percentage: Indicates the effectiveness of serves.
  • Reception Errors: Tracks mistakes made during reception.
  • These metrics help coaches evaluate strategies. They also guide training focus. For instance, a high attack efficiency suggests strong offensive capabilities. Conversely, frequent reception errors indicate areas needing improvement. Each statistic contributes to a comprehensive understanding of the game. Data analysis is vital for success.     Understanding Basic Volleyball Statistics

    Points Scored and Their Impact

    Points scored in volleyball directly influence match outcomes and team morale. Each point represents a critical moment in the game. Understanding how points are accumulated is essential for strategic planning. Key factors include:

  • Attack Points: Points earned through successful attacks.
  • Service Aces: Points scored direvtly from serves.
  • Block Points: Points gained from successful blocks.
  • These metrics provide insight into offensive and defensive strengths. A high number of attack points indicates effective offensive strategies. Conversely, a lack of service aces may suggest areas for improvement. Each point scored can shift momentum. Coaches must analyze these statistics closely. Every point counts in competitive play.

    Understanding Errors and Their Consequences

    Errors in volleyball can significantly impact a team’s performance and overall match outcome. Understanding the types of errors is crucial for effective strategy development. Key error categories include:

  • Service Errors: Mistakes made during serves.
  • Attack Errors: Failed attempts to score points.
  • Reception Errors: Mistakes in receiving the ball.
  • Each error not only costs points but can also shift momentum. A high number of service errors indicates a need for focused training. Attack errors can reveal weaknesses in offensive strategies. Coaches must analyze these errors to mitigate their effects. Every mistake has consequences. Identifying patterns in errors can lead to improved performance.     Advanced Statistical Metrics

    Analyzing Serve Efficiency

    Analyzing serve efficiency is vital for optimizing team performance. This metric evaluates the effectiveness of serves in contributing to points scored. Key components include:

  • Ace Percentage: The ratio of aces to total serves.
  • Error Rate: The frequency of service errors.
  • A high ace percentage indicates a strong serving strategy. Conversely, a high error rate can undermine overall performance. Coaches should focus on improving serve efficiency through targeted drills. Each serve is an opportunity to gain an advantage. Understanding these metrics allows for informed decision-making.     Block and Dig Statistics Explained

    Block and dig statistics are essential for evaluating defensive performance in volleyball. These metrics provide insights into a team’s ability to prevent points. Key statistics include:

  • Block Success Rate: The percentage of successful blocks.
  • Dig Efficiency: The ratio of successful digs to total attempts.
  • A high block success rate indicates effective defensive strategies. Conversely, low dig efficiency may highlight areas needing improvement. Coaches analyze these statistics to refine training methods. Each block can shift the momentum of a match. Understanding these metrics allows for strategic adjustments.     Using Statistics for Game Strategy

    Identifying Opponent Weaknesses

    Identifying opponent weaknesses is important for developing effective game strategies . By analyzing statistical data, coaches can pinpoint areas where opponents struggle. Key metrics to consider include serve reception errors and attack efficiency. A high rate of serve reception errors indicates vulnerability in the opponent’s defense. Targeting these weaknesses can lead to scoring opportunities. Additionally, understanding an opponent’s attack efficiency can reveal their offensive patterns. This knowledge allows teams to adjust their defensive strategies accordingly. Each statistic provides valuable insights. Data-driven strategies enhance competitive advantage.     Tools and Resources for Analyzing Statistics

    Software and Apps for Volleyball Stats

    Various software and apps are available for analyzing volleyball statistics effectively. These tools help coaches and players track performance metrics in real-time. Popular options include:

  • Volleyball Stat Tracker: Offers comprehensive data collection.
  • StatCrew: Provides detailed statistical analysis.
  • Hudl: Combines video analysis with stats.
  • Each application allows for customized reporting and data visualization. This capability enhances understanding of player performance and team dynamics. Coaches can identify trends and make informed decisions. Data-driven insights lead to strategic improvements. Every tool has unique features. Choosing the right software is crucial.

    Online Resources and Communities

    Online resources and communities play a vital role in enhancing volleyball statistics analysis. Websites such as VolleyMetrics and the AVCA provide valuable insights and tools for coaches and players. These platforms offer access to statistical databases, articles, and forums for discussion. Engaging with these communities allows individuals to share experiences and strategies. This collaboration fosters a deeper understanding of the game. Additionally, social media groups can provide real-time updates and tips. Each resource contributes to a comprehensive knowledge base. Coaches can leverage these insights for better decision-making.
